How to destress your body?
To quickly destress your body, activate your parasympathetic nervous system by practicing deep diaphragmatic breathing or by using cold water. Inhale deeply, allowing your belly to rise, and exhale twice as long as you inhale. Alternatively, splashing cold water on your face triggers the mammalian dive reflex, immediately slowing your heart rate.

What is the #1 worst habit for anxiety?
The #1 worst habit for anxiety is avoidance. While avoiding anxiety-inducing situations (like social events, phone calls, or public speaking) provides immediate short-term relief, it ultimately reinforces your fear, shrinks your comfort zone, and worsens anxiety in the long run.

How can I stop stressing?
To stop stressing, quickly calm your physical nervous system using the 4-7-8 breathing method: inhale for 4 seconds, hold for 7, and exhale slowly for 8. Break the mental loop by shifting focus to the present, writing down concerns to offload mental weight, or getting a brisk walk to boost endorphins.

What drink relaxes the brain?
To quickly relax your mind, sip on warm chamomile or green tea. Chamomile contains apigenin, an antioxidant that naturally promotes calmness, while green tea contains L-theanine, which reduces stress without making you drowsy.
